What is the average price of a house in Richmond?

The average price for a house in Richmond is £536k, costing on average £908 per sqft.

Average prices of houses by bedroom count are: £285k for a two-bedroom, £349k for a three-bedroom, £565k for a four-bedroom, and £747k for a five-bedroom.

What share of houses in Richmond feature gardens and parking?

In Richmond, 94% of houses have a garden and 92% include parking.

What is the breakdown of property types in Richmond?

The housing mix in Richmond is 50% detached, 28% semi-detached, 14% terraced, and 9% other.

What is the most expensive area in Richmond to buy a home?

The most expensive area to buy a house in Richmond is DL11, where the average property is £717k.

What is the cheapest area in Richmond to buy a home?

The cheapest area to buy a house in Richmond is DL10, where the average property is £356k.

What is the average price of a flat in Richmond?

The average price for a flat in Richmond is £196k, costing on average £164 per sqft.

Average prices of flats by bedroom count are: £125k for a one-bedroom, £231k for a two-bedroom, £425k for a three-bedroom, and N/A for a four-bedroom.

What share of flats in Richmond feature balconies and parking?

In Richmond, 9% of flats have a balcony and 91% include parking.

What is the breakdown of lease types in Richmond?

The leasing mix in Richmond is 87% leasehold and 14% freehold.

What is the most expensive area in Richmond to buy a flat?

The most expensive area to buy a flat in Richmond is DL10, where the average property is £226k.

What is the cheapest area in Richmond to buy a flat?

The cheapest area to buy a flat in Richmond is DL11, where the average property is £165k.
